## v2.9.0 — Blue-green deploys for billing worker

The Ledgerfox billing worker now deploys blue-green. Traffic cuts over only after the green pool passes the invoice-replay smoke test; rollback is a single cutover revert, no redeploy needed. On-call: do not drain the blue pool manually during the soak window, and do not restart workers mid-cutover — in-flight charge jobs will be duplicated. Cutover status is visible on the Ledgerfox deploy dashboard. If a cutover stalls past fifteen minutes, page the deploy owner named below.

account owner for bawip-tahag: Raleth Quenok

## Deployment

Loggle, our audit-log viewer, deploys as a single container behind the Trellick ingress. Builds are promoted from staging after the smoke suite passes. Rollbacks use the previous image tag; no data migration is required. Before approving, confirm the environment matches the values below.

deployment values, yadug-bawif:
[framir]
team = pelox
access_code = ac_a38ab2
owner = tamion.julael
host = framir.tolvaqlabs.test
port = 11211
peer = tammir.zemvargrid.local
salt = 2215ef03
pin = 1541

## Tuning

Bulk edits in the Quorrel admin table run in chunked transactions. Don't raise chunk size past what staging can absorb; the audit log writes synchronously. If edits stall, lower concurrency before touching timeouts. Defaults below work for most tenants. The current tuning constants are listed here.

tuning constants:
QUOTAS = {
    "druwyn": 5,
    "holix": 5,
    "zorath": 5,
    "holwyn": 10,
}

Subject: Quickstore 4.2 — bloom filter now fronts the KV layer

Plugin authors: starting with this release, Quickstore places a bloom filter ahead of the key-value store. Negative lookups return faster; false positives fall through safely. No API changes are required on your side. Verify your plugin against the staging build referenced below.

session token of fahif-tadup = htk3_9c7